Parotia carolae meeki Rothschild View in CoL

Parotia carolae meeki Rothschild, 1910b: 35 View in CoL (Letekwa River, Dutch New Guinea, 2000– 2500 feet).

Now Parotia carolae meeki Rothschild, 1910 View in CoL . See Hartert, 1919: 128; Mayr, 1962d: 195; Gilliard, 1969: 176–181; Cracraft, 1992: 26–27; Frith and Beehler, 1998: 298–304; and Frith and Frith, 2009b: 472.

LECTOTYPE: AMNH 678161 View Materials , male molting into adult plumage, collected near the Otakwa River Valley , 2500 ft, Pegunungan Maoke (= Snow Mountains), Papua Province, Indonesia (formerly Dutch New Guinea), on 1 August 1910, by Albert S. Meek (no. 4558). From the Rothschild Collection.

COMMENTS: No type was designated in the original description, but immature male and female were described. Rothschild and Hartert (1913) reported on Meek’s entire collection, and on page 523 listed the specimens collected, still without designating a type. Hartert (1919: 128), by listing the type as Meek’s no. 4558, designated it the lectotype. Paralectotypes, all collected in 1910, are: Snow Mountains, AMNH 678162 (Meek no. 4846), adult male, 17 October, AMNH 678163 (4913), AMNH 678164 (4914), two males molting into adult male plumage, both collected 29 October, AMNH 678165–678167 (4951, 4896, 4610), three females, collected 23 August–4 November. Of these, AMNH 678166 was exchanged to FMNH in the 1960s. When Meek (1913: 219) left the Otakwa River, he sent his collection from Merauke to Europe. When Rothschild named P. c. meeki , published 31 December 1910, he probably had just received this shipment. Specimens collected on Mount Goliath in 1911 are not part of the type series.

The collecting locality as given in the original description is undoubtedly a misprint for Setekwa River, 04.34S, 137.21E ( Frith and Beehler, 1998: 570), a tributary of the Otakwa River, spelled ‘‘Utakwa’’ on Meek’s label, 04.20S, 137.14E ( Frith and Beehler, 1998: 571); Oetakwa is the Dutch spelling, now usually spelled Otakwa. See Rothschild and Hartert (1913: 473) and LeCroy and Jansen (2011: 182) for further information on Meek’s collecting localities.
